The Habersham County Commission (HCC) will be asked Monday to consider approving an intergovernmental agreement (IGA) with the cities and towns in the county for the imposition of a new Local Option Sales Tax.
The seven municipalities in the county – Alto, Baldwin, Clarkesville, Cornelia, Demorest, Mount Airy, and Tallulah Falls – are already on board, having approved the (IGA).
This is one, a one cent tax known as a FLOST or PTRLOST, would bring about, if approved by the voters, a reduction in property taxes. The referendum would be held during the Nov. 3 General Election.
